The Basics of Engine Performance
Engine performance is determined by several factors, including fuel efficiency, power output, and responsiveness. An efficient engine works optimally under various conditions and provides a smooth driving experience.
Factors Affecting Engine Performance
Several components play a role in determining engine performance:
- Fuel Quality: High-quality fuel can enhance engine performance and efficiency.
- Air Intake System: Proper airflow is crucial for combustion, affecting horsepower and torque.
- Ignition System: A well-functioning ignition system ensures a complete burn of fuel, maximizing power output.
Regular Maintenance Practices
To maintain optimal engine performance, regular maintenance is crucial. This includes:
1. Oil Changes
Regular oil changes are vital for lubricating engine components and preventing wear.
2. Air Filter Replacement
Replacing air filters regularly ensures that the engine receives adequate airflow.
3. Spark Plug Checks
Regular inspection and replacement of spark plugs ensure efficient ignition and performance.
